摘要: 在网格安全标准中,实体间的跨域身份认证采用基于证书的公钥基础设施认证框架,证书的管理过于复杂,限制了网格规模的扩大。针对上述问题,在分析网格安全需求的基础上,引入基于身份的密码体制,提出一种跨域签密方案,以解决使用不同系统参数的虚拟组织间相互认证的问题,并对其安全性和性能进行分析。

Abstract: In Grid Security Infrastructure(GSI), cross-domain authentication between entities adopts the traditional certificate-based Public Key Infrastructure(PKI) which limits grid scale since the management of certificates is too complicated. By analyzing the security demands, this paper introduces Identity-Based Cryptography(IBC) to grid and proposes a cross-domain signcryption scheme to solve the problem brought by authentication between Virtual Organizations(VO) with different system parameters. Its security and performance are analyzed.
